LionCage Shredding, New York City’s Leading Document Shredding Company, Proudly Partners with the NYPD to Combat Identity Theft in All Five Boroughs

The New York City Police Department Partners with LionCage Shredding, New York's Trusted Leader in Document Shredding and Hard Drive Destruction, to Fight Identity Theft

NEW YORK, Nov. 29, 2013 /PRNewswire/ — Identity theft is one of the most serious and fastest-growing white-collar crimes in the United States, a fact which much of the population remains blissfully ignorant of. Additionally, even those who do grasp the seriousness of identity theft do not fully comprehend its frequency, opting instead to view themselves as somehow immune to such criminal activity.

Unfortunately this attitude causes many individuals to overlook the necessity of security measures such as effective document shredding or complete hard drive destruction. This lack of security consciousness is one of the primary reasons identity theft has been allowed to run rampant throughout the United States.

In the hopes of combating such criminal activity, the NYPD and LionCage Shredding have banded together to make destroying personal and potentially compromising information easier and more accessible than ever. In an effort to raise consciousness of America's most widespread white-collar crime, LionCage has agreed to make the state-of-the-art, environmentally friendly MDX-1 Mobile Shredding Unit from its fleet available for public use on the 1st Sunday of each month.

The precise location of these New York City document-shredding stations will vary throughout the five boroughs in the hopes of raising public awareness and providing easy access to secure document shredding throughout New York City.

The first such public document-shredding station will take place at the Staten Island Mall on Sunday, December 1, 2013 between the hours of 11 am and 2 pm.

All paper will be shredded on location in a LionCage state-of-the-art shredding truck and 100% of the paper will be recycled.
